eMusic service is NO SERVICE!
Complaint Rating:  100 % with 2 votes
Company information:
eMusic.com
United States
www.emusic.com

My daughter received a certificate through Radio Disney - for "free" I-Pod downloads thru E-Music. When we went online to get these "free" downloads we had to complete a registration and subscribe. It was said that there was no obligation and that the membership could be cancelled (kind of like a free trial type thing) - yet we had to provide a credit card #. We never got to the point of being able to download any music and decided we didn't want to go further. We submitted a request to cancel the service right away. We rec'd notice the account was cancelled - however we received a charge on the credit card. The following month we were charged again. I went online trying to find contact info - there is nothing. I cancelled the acct again - this time printing the receipt of cancellation. The following month I was charged yet again! This has continued for about 5 months now - each month I have disputed the charges thru my credit card company and each month tried to find a way to get E-music to stop charging the card. I recently noticed there was a phone # on the credit card statement. I called the # and the automated line says "to cancel your service by e-mail, press 1", to cancel your service by...press 2" to cancel your service by phone press 3" - those are the only options - obviously people are not happy w/ them! Anyhow I thought "oh wow! I have another route to get this resolved" - so I pressed 3 to cancel by phone. Guess what?? It directs you to go to the internet to cancel. I am very frustrated with this companies lack of service on all levels. I have never and will never use or recommend this company to anyone.
